Central Railway Megablock on Harbour Line in Mumbai Today

Mumbai: Central Railway's Mumbai Division will operate a megablock on its Harbour Line between Chhatrapati Shivaji Maharaj Terminus (CSMT) and Chunabhatti/Bandra sections to carry out various engineering and maintenance works today.

No Megablock on Main Line

There will be no megablock on the Main Line between CSMT and Karjat/Kasara, which will be a relief for several commuters travelling by local trains on Sunday.

Block Timings and Details

On the Harbour Line, the block will be in place on the CSMT–Chunabhatti/Bandra down line from 11:40 am to 4:40 pm, and on the Chunabhatti/Bandra–CSMT up line from 11:10 am to 4:10 pm. Special services will run between Panvel and Kurla (Platform No. 8) at a frequency of 20 minutes during the block period.

Alternative Travel Options

Harbour Line passengers are permitted to travel via the Main Line and Western Railway until 6 pm during the block period, an official said.
